Output 508303a557f63bcf3ef188466c8af8fc0d8af1f7aa3873f087d60278a3d60537:0

value
156264105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aa19f71370efb7ea76f8cf83d67cb4076ea02db OP_EQUAL
address
MK5aHapoXonQbjwn9FccoYtRGdPKLbfY4v
transaction
508303a557f63bcf3ef188466c8af8fc0d8af1f7aa3873f087d60278a3d60537
spent
true